Ingredients
Scale
Fondue
- 12 oz Semi-Sweet Chocolate Chips
- 6 oz Milk Chocolate Chips
- 1 cup Heavy Whipping Cream
- 1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ract
- 1/8 teaspoon Salt
Dippers
- Marshmallows
- Graham Crackers
- Pretzels
- Fresh Fruit (such as strawberries, banana slices, apple wedges)
- Cake pieces
Instructions
- Prepare the crock pot: Place the semi-sweet chocolate chips, milk chocolate chips, heavy whipping cream, vanilla extract, and salt into a small 2-quart crock pot. Make sure the ingredients are evenly distributed for even melting.
- Cook the fondue: Cover the crock pot and set it to low heat. Allow the mixture to cook for 1 to 2 hours, stirring every 20 to 30 minutes. This helps the chocolate melt smoothly and prevents scorching or clumping, resulting in a rich, creamy fondue.
- Serve and enjoy: Once the chocolate is fully melted and smooth, transfer the crock pot to your serving area and keep it on the warm setting if available to maintain temperature. Serve with your favorite dippers like marshmallows, graham crackers, pretzels, fruit, or cake for dipping and enjoy this delightful dessert.
Notes
- Use a 2-quart crock pot for even cooking and easy stirring.
- Stir regularly to prevent chocolate from sticking or burning on the bottom.
- You can substitute heavy whipping cream with half-and-half for a lighter option, but the fondue may be less creamy.
- Keep the fondue warm on the crock pot’s low or warm setting while serving to maintain the perfect dipping consistency.
- Feel free to experiment with different dipping options like pound cake, biscotti, or fresh berries.
